Allianz Lanka in Trincomalee

Allianz Lanka consolidated plans for reaching into the East with the opening of its first Eastern branch office in the heart of Trincomalee, located at 447/2, Dockyard Road. The Branch Manager is Jacob Predeepen with an experienced team of sales, front office and underwriting professionals trained to the internationally benchmarked Allianz standards of customer service and underwriting.

This is the Munich based conglomerate - Allianz's eighth venture into the provinces of Sri Lanka, and the second of its branches in the North East. The company opened a branch in the North, in Jaffna, last December. Chief Guest at the inaugural ceremony was AGA Trincomalee, Arumugam Nadaraja.

NCCSL seminar

A seminar themed "U.K and Sri Lanka: Partners in Prosperity" will be held on October 14 from 2.00 pm - 3.30 pm at the National Chamber Auditorium, No. 450, D.R. Wijewardene Mw, Colombo 10. At this seminar participants will be briefed on "U.K Economy, investment opportunities, Doing Business in the U.K successfully and how the British High Commission can help Sri Lankan businessmen". Deputy High Commissioner of the U.K High Commission in Sri Lanka Mark Gooding will be the Keynote Speaker and Ms Janet Ford, Head of U.K. Trade will also speak at this seminar. Any issues Sri Lankan businessmen have when dealing with their counterparts in U.K could also be taken up.
